django原生的序列化serialize解析

在写接口的时候,大家都离不开对query结果集的序列化
嗯嗯嗯,一般我们都有DRF里面的序列化工具,但是django原生的serialize你们有
用过吗?????????????

上代码:

from django.core.serializers import serialize

class Test(APIView):
	def get(self,request):
		origin_data = Test.objects.all()
		serialized_data = serialize('json',origin_data)
		return HttpResponse(serialized_data )

当然,再有更便捷的工具的情况下,这种方法并不常用
在有特定需要的时候,使用这种django原生序列化,还是十分方便的

你可能感兴趣的:(django,序列化,python)